Issues, Repurchases, and Repayments of Debt and Equity Securities There is no issues, repurchases, and repayments of debts and equity securities of the Group during the current financial quarter and period except for:- i. On 13 September 2021, the Company announced the fixed issue price of 241,568,000 private placement shares at RM0.036 each and were issued on 14 September 2021. ii. On 14 September 2021, 73,915,000 shares options were offered to eligible employee at an exercise price of RM0.0425 each and were expired. iii. On 25 November 2021, 73,915,000 shares option were offered to eligible employee at an exercise price of RM0.035 each and were expired.

Changes in Composition of the Group On 30 August 2021, the Company entered into a share sales agreement to acquire 2,500,000 ordinary shares at RM1.00 for a total consideration of RM5,000,000 representing 100% shareholdings of Ikhlas Al Dain Sdn Bhd (“IKHLAS”). The acquisition was completed on 9 November 2021. On 6 December 2021, the Company acquired an additional 49% equity interest in its subsidiary, Pacifica Direct Sdn. Bhd. (“PDSB”) comprising 98,000 ordinary shares from a non-controlling shareholder for a cash consideration of RM100,000. Subsequently, PDSB become a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company.

Fair value hierarchy The table below analyses financial instrument carried at fair value, by valuation method. The different levels have been defined as follows: Level 1: Quoted prices (unadjusted) in active markets for identical assets or liabilities. Level 2: Inputs other than quoted prices included within Level 1 that are observable for assets or liabilities, either directly (i.e. as prices) or indirectly (i.e. derived from prices). Level 3: Inputs for the assets or liabilities that are not based on observable market data (unobservable inputs). Prospects The economic outlook for FYE2022 remains uncertain with the COVID-19 pandemic continuing to affect economies globally with rising infection rate impacting businesses and communities. Despite these challenges, the Group is optimistic on the business potential of the ICT industry. The Group will continue to enhance its current digitalisation solutions to remain competitive in the industry. To further strengthen the Group’s position as one of the key players in the market, we collaborate with strategic partners to create synergy and enhance our portfolio of innovative technological offerings. The Group’s virtual event platform and services were launched in FYE 2020 to cater for demand from organisations to hold virtual events to meet their statutory and regulatory compliance requirements during and after the Covid restriction periods. To date, we have conducted over 120 virtual general meetings for public limited companies. The Group’s subsidiary in Taiwan, Inbase Partners Limited (“Inbase”) offers cutting edge fintech and digital advisory services. Despite the pandemic affecting economic activities in Taiwan, Inbase’s business and operations were not materially affected as most of its businesses were conducted online. Inbase is continually identifying and developing other business opportunities to enhance its business. These include investment in digital assets and precious metals by using its in-house proprietary and other digital platforms. Inbase’s new digital platform codenamed “Catch Markets” started live operations in Q4 2021. The Group expects to see revenue generated from this platform in the third quarter of 2022. After the long period of MCO since 2020, Longhouse Films Sdn Bhd (“Longhouse”) is currently on track to kick start a number of projects this financial year. The investment in Movie “The Assistant” was launched in cinema on 19 May 2022. “My Ofis” a drama produced by Longhouse is scheduled to launch on 26 May 2022 through iQiyi Over-the-Top (OTT) platform. The acquisition of Ikhlas was completed on 9 November 2021. Ikhlas is approved by Ministry of Finance to conduct the business of factoring, development financing, leasing and building credit since 2011. The newly acquired subsidiary will provide an opportunity for the Group to enhance its revenue and earnings by tapping into factoring business which business model can be transformed and improved with the use of the Group’s digital technology. Ikhlas started operation in January 2022. Ikhlas is expected to contribute positively in this financial year.

MLabs Systems Unit to Acquire Malaysia-based Financial Services Provider Aug 31, 2021, 13:28MT Newswires M MLAB 0.025 MLabs Systems (MLAB) subsidiary MLabs Capital agreed to acquire financial services provider Ikhlas Al Dain for 5 million ringgit ($1.2 million) in cash.
Under the agreement, MLabs Capital will purchase a total of 2.5 million shares in Ikhlas from investment manager Fiscalab Altinvest.
With the acquisition, Mlabs Systems will be able to foray into the factoring business, according to a Monday filing.
MLabs Systems said the transaction will be funded through internally generated funds.

Box office ticket sales also represent a large chunk of the revenue source for the industry. When cinemas closed their doors to comply with Covid-19 restrictions, that revenue tap was shut off entirely.
Movies that went up the silver screen shortly before the national lockdown kicked in only managed to recoup a fraction of the cost that went into producing a film.
Longhouse Films managing director Dianne Tan reveals that these events are merely symptoms of underlying problems that have long plagued the local film industry, the core of which is the lack of a reliable commercialisation model. From the way local films are financed to the direction of content, the sustainability of the industry was questionable even before the pandemic.
Thankfully, international platforms such as Netflix, Disney Plus and iQiyi have opened up more revenue channels for the industry. The rise in digital content consumption and advancements in data analytic techniques have also made it possible for films to partner with consumer brands, further expanding commercial opportunities.
